Skip to content

GitLab

  • Menu
Projects Groups Snippets
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
  • Sign in / Register
  • S slapos.core
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Merge requests 31
    • Merge requests 31
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Schedules
  • Deployments
    • Deployments
    • Environments
    • Releases
  • Analytics
    • Analytics
    • Value stream
    • CI/CD
    • Repository
  • Activity
  • Graph
  • Jobs
  • Commits
Collapse sidebar
  • nexedi
  • slapos.core
  • Merge requests
  • !298

Merged
Created May 12, 2021 by Xavier Thompson@xavier_thompsonOwner

slapgrid: Add --force-stop option

  • Overview 48
  • Commits 1
  • Changes 3

Add a --force-stop option to instance processing, as in: slapos node instance --force-stop

This option affects how started partition are processed:

  • buildout is processed normally
  • the timestamp is ignored and not updated
  • the services are stopped instead of started
  • no promises are run
  • no report is sent to master

This is useful when we want to do as much work as possible in advance (run buildout, create configuration files, etc), without actually starting the instance, e.g. for resilient clones.

Edited Jun 11, 2021 by Xavier Thompson
Assignee
Assign to
Reviewer
Request review from
Time tracking
Source branch: slapgrid_no_supervisord
GitLab Nexedi Edition | About GitLab | About Nexedi | 沪ICP备2021021310号-2 | 沪ICP备2021021310号-7